I'm Jack from WV. I just purchased the PBV4PS2 Saturday afternoon and after about 1 hr it was put together. I like how well constructed it is, it's unusual in today's world to get your money worth in a product. I did the burn-off yesterday and it took a while to get over 350. And I don't care much for the 50-degree increments. But after some research, there seems to be a fix so hopefully, the company will support me with it. And it doesn't put out much smoke for a smoker.

I'm used to smoking everything on a weber with charcoal and wood. So I like the wifi connection on this smoker. And the time to temperature of the pork shoulder seems to be in line with all my other cooks on the weber. It just seems to be using a lot of pellets but it is in the 30's here but with my charcoal, I bet I would still only go through about $5 worth.

But in the end, my pulled pork is getting done and it smells great. I don't mean to make it sound like I hate the smoker. It's well built and I hope they will fix my controller. I do wish it had a smoke setting on it like the others that I researched before I bought this one. But no lowes near me had the copperhead.

Anyway I think it'll be a good smoker that will last for a long while. And I wanted to say hey!
 
The smoke setting is how it comes up when you power it up.....it says "S" on the screen. If you change the temperature....it goes S - 150 - 175 - 200....etc. I ran mine at 150 for an hour for chicken and it had a wonderful smokey flavor....
